CNN has canceled former Republican Senator and Presidential candidate Rick Santorum for stating how European immigrants former America as a nation during a speech last month.

“We birthed a nation from nothing, Yes, there were Native Americans, but there isn’t much Native American culture in American culture,” Santorum said at the time.

Santorum was a senior political commentator at CNN who was one of the few Republican points of views on the network and was often tasked with campaign coverage.
